What is requirment phase testing?



What is requirment phase testing?..

Answer / washim raza

Requirement Phase testing is basically done in the process of requirement collection, If suppose one existing system is already available and you are in a phase where the requirements are being collected, at that point of time the requirements are evaluated whether they are not contradicting with the existing features of the system, if it is there then how to over come it is also need to be decided during the requirement phase testing so that there wont be any big deviations during the implementation and developement..
